Strategy

Winning isn’t about brute force; it’s about reading the invisible currents. Early on, focus on staying near the center. The attractor fields are weaker there, giving you breathing room. As you collect points, the fields intensify, pulling you toward the edges where danger spikes. Use dashes to break free from a sudden pull, then reposition quickly. Timing your dash right after a field shift can let you skim the edge for extra points without getting caught. Keep an eye on the pulse meter—when it spikes, the arena’s gravity flips, and every wall becomes a trap. Adaptation is the name of the game; the more you adjust, the longer your survival streak.
